Let the platform do the work

Microsoft Dynamics CRM Mappings

Overview

This page shows how the fields in your Microsoft Dynamics CRM instance map to Sugar Market's internal CRM. This is important for knowing what fields to map to in a landing page and in identifying how data flows between Sugar Market and Microsoft Dynamics CRM. See the Integration Overview for information on the Sugar Market sync process.

Accounts

Microsoft Field

Sugar Market Field

--

AccountID (primary key)

Microsoft's Account ID (primary key)

ID

Name

AccountName

OwnerID (foreign key)

OwnerID (foreign key)

Contacts and Leads

Sugar Market does not have a Leads table, but they are differentiated in the Contacts table by the CRMType field.

Microsoft Field

Sugar Market Field

--

ContactID (primary key)

Microsoft's Contact ID (primary key)

ID

Microsoft's Account ID (foreign key)

AccountID (foreign key)

OwnerID (foreign key)

OwnerID (foreign key)

--

CRMType*

--

CreatedDate

--

LastUpdate

CreatedOn

ExternalCRMCreatedDate

ModifiedOn1

ExternalCRMUpdatedDate

FirstName

FirstName

LastName

LastName

EmailAddress1

Email

ParentCustomer

Account Lookup (Contacts only)

CompanyName

Account Lookup (Lead only)

DoNotSendMM

DONOTSENDMARKETINGMATERIALNAME

DoNotBulkEmail

OpOut

(Does not map)

Source

JobTitle

Title

Telephone1

Phone

MobilePhone

MobilePhone

Address1_Line1

--

Address1_Line2

--

Address1_Line3

--

Address1_City

--

Address1_State

--

Address1_StateOrProvince

--

Address1_PostalCode

--

Address1_Country

--

Address1_County

--

Address1_Fax

--

Address1_Telephone1

--

Address1_Telephone2

--

Address1_Telephone3

--

1 The ModifiedOn field is the field that Sugar Market uses to determine if the record has been updated since the last successful sync to evaluate if the record needs to be synced.

Opportunities

Microsoft Field

Sugar Market Field

--

OpportunityID (primary key)

Microsoft's Opportunity ID (primary key)

ID

Microsoft's Account ID (foreign key)

AccountID (foreign key)

OwnerID (foreign key)

OwnerID (foreign key)

Description

--

Closing_Date

--

Est_Closing_Date

--

Users

Microsoft Field

Sugar Market Field

--

UserID (primary key)

Microsoft's user ID (primary key)

ID

FirstName

First_name

LastName

Last_name

Username

Username

FullName

Name

Address1_Telephone1

Phone_Number

Address1_Line1

Address1

Address1_Line2

Address2

Address1_City

City

Address1_StateOrProvince

State

Address1_PostalCode

Zip

Address1_Country

Country

JobTitle

JobTitle

MobilePhone

Cell

Salutation

Salutation

Push Only - Sugar Market's Task to Microsoft's Activity

Microsoft Field

Sugar Market Field

--

TaskID (primary key)

Microsoft's Activity ID (primary key)

ID

Microsoft's ContactID (foreign key)

ContactID (foreign key)

ContactName

Contact.FirstName + Contact.LastName

ActualStart

DueDate

ScheduledStart

DueDate

Actual End

DueDate

Description

Comments

Subject

Subject

Note: If Sugar Market Task.Status is set as "Complete" through a Sugar Market automation we'll push the Status up as "Complete", otherwise we will push the task up as "ToDo."

Custom Entities

Ma_campaignemail (Campaign Email)

CRM Field

Type\Size

Relationship

new_alertcrm

Number

Direct

new_assetid

Number

Direct

new_body

String (2000)

Direct

new_bodynohtml

String (2000)

Direct

new_bodysource

String (100)

Direct

ma_campaignemailid

Lookup (CampaignActivity)

Lookup (CampaignActivity)

new_campaignerid

Number

Direct

new_campaignertype

Option Set

Direct

new_campaignid

Lookup (Campaign)

Lookup (Campaign)

new_clicked

Number

Direct

new_deliverymessage

String (100)

Direct

new_deliverystatus

Option Set

Direct

new_displayname

String (100)

Direct

new_dynamiccontentid

Number

Direct

new_forms

Number

Direct

new_friendforward

Number

Direct

new_fromemail

String (100)

Direct

new_fusionscore

Number

Direct

new_header

String (100)

Direct

new_id

String (100)

Direct

new_idclick

String (100)

Direct

new_idopen

String (100)

Direct

ma_nurtureleadid

Lookup (Lead)

Direct

new_opened

Number

Direct

new_postdate

Datetime

Direct

new_recipientid

Number

Direct

new_regardingcontactid

Lookup (Contact)

Lookup (Contact)

new_regardingid

Lookup (Lead)

Lookup (Lead)

new_sender

String (100)

Direct

new_campaignsubject

String (100)

Direct

new_threadnum

Number

Direct

new_toemail

String (100)

Direct

new_unsub

Number

Direct

Ma_campaignerclick (Campaign Clicks)

CRM Field

Type\Size

Relationship

ma_campaignemail

Lookup (Campaign Email)

Lookup (Campaign Email)

ma_campaignemailName

String (250)

Direct

ma_campaignerclickId

Unique ID

Unique ID

ma_LinksClickedId

Lookup (Campaign Activity)

Lookup (Campaign Activity)

ma_LinksClickedIdName

String (200)

Direct

new_CampaignerId

Integer

Direct

new_CampaignerLinkId

Integer

Direct

new_CampaignId

Lookup (Campaign)

Lookup (Campaign)

new_CampaignIdName

String (250)

Direct

new_ContactId

Lookup (Contact)

Lookup (Contact)

new_ContactIdName

String (160)

Direct

new_ContactIdYomiName

String (450)

Direct

new_LeadId

Lookup (Lead)

Lookup (Lead)

new_LeadIdName

String (160)

Direct

new_LeadIdYomiName

String (450)

Direct

new_LinkOrder

Integer

Direct

new_name

String (100)

Direct

new_rURL

String (200)

Direct

new_ToEmail

String (100)

Direct

new_WebSessionId

String (100)

Direct

Ma_dialog (Landing Pages)

CRM Field

Type\Size

Relationship

ma_completedDate

Date Time

Direct

ma_Contact

Lookup (Contact)

Lookup (Contact)

ma_ContactName

String (160)

Direct

ma_ContactYomiName

String (450)

Direct

ma_dialogId

Unique ID

Unique ID

ma_DialogResponse

Memo (32768)

Direct

ma_Fusionid

Integer

Direct

ma_Lead

Lookup (Lead)

Lookup (Lead)

ma_LeadName

String (160)

Direct

ma_LeadYomiName

String (450)

Direct

ma_name

String (255)

Direct

ma_StartformID

Integer

Direct

Ma_event (Events)

CRM Field

Type\Size

Relationship

ma_Attended

Boolean

Direct

ma_Contact

Lookup (Contact)

Lookup (Contact)

ma_ContactName

String (160)

Direct

ma_ContactYomiName

String (450)

Direct

ma_Duration

Integer

Direct

ma_EventDate

DateTime

Direct

ma_eventId

Unique ID

Unique ID

ma_EventLocation

String (255)

Direct

ma_eventname

String (255)

Direct

ma_Fusionid

String (100)

Direct

ma_Lead

Lookup (Lead)

Lookup (Lead)

ma_LeadName

String (160)

Direct

ma_LeadSource

String (255)

Direct

ma_LeadYomiName

String (450)

Direct

ma_name

String (255)

Direct

ma_Registered

Boolean

Direct

Ma_recyclebin (Recycle Bin)

CRM Field

Type\Size

Relationship

new_EntityID

String (100)

Direct

new_EntityType

String (50)

Direct

new_name

String (100)

Direct

new_Processed

String (5)

Direct

new_ProcessedDate

DateTime

Format: DateOnly

new_ProcessedNotes

String (500)

Direct

Ma_webactivity (Web Activity)

CRM Field

Type\Size

Relationship

new_RegardingAccountId

Lookup (Account)

Account.AccountName = WebActivity.OrganizationName

new_RegardingAccountIdName

String (160)

Based off of new_RegardingAccountId

new_RegardingAccountIdYomiName

String (160)

Based off of new_RegardingAccountId

new_RegardingContactId

Lookup (Contact)

Contacts.Email = WebActivity.EmailAddress

new_RegardingContactIdName

String (160)

Based off of new_RegardingContactId

new_RegardingContactIdYomiName

String (450)

Based off of new_RegardingContactId

new_RegardingId

Lookup (Lead)

Contacts.Email = WebActivity.EmailAddress

new_RegardingIdName

String (160)

Based off of new_RegardingId

new_RegardingIdYomiName

String (450)

Based off of new_RegardingId

new_ScoreWebActivityDetails

Integer

Direct

markauto_AreaCode

Integer

Direct

markauto_BrowserLanguage

String (100)

Direct

markauto_City

String (100)

Direct

markauto_ClientHostname

String (150)

Direct

markauto_ClientIP

String (50)

Direct

markauto_ColorDepth

String (4)

Direct

markauto_CountryCode

String (50)

Direct

markauto_CountryName

String (50)

Direct

markauto_CRMType

String (25)

Direct

markauto_dma_code

Integer

Direct

markauto_Duration

Decimal

Direct

markauto_EmailAddress

String (150)

Direct

markauto_EndDate

DateTime

Direct

markauto_Hemisphere

String (10)

Direct

markauto_IndentifiedBy

String (16)

Direct

markauto_ISP

String (100)

Direct

markauto_JavaEnabled

Boolean

Direct

markauto_JavaScriptVersion

String (8)

Direct

markauto_Latitude

Double

Direct

markauto_Longitude

Double

Direct

markauto_OperatingSystem

String (16)

Direct

markauto_OrganizationName

String (100)

Direct

markauto_PixelDepth

String (4)

Direct

markauto_PostalCode

String (25)

Direct

markauto_RecipientID

String (100)

Direct

markauto_ReferrerDomain

String (50)

Direct

markauto_ReferrerKeywords

String (1000)

Direct

markauto_ReferrerQuery

String (1000)

Direct

markauto_ReferrerReferrer

String (1000)

Direct

markauto_region

String (50)

Direct

markauto_Resolution

String (16)

Direct

markauto_Scoring

Integer

Direct

markauto_Source

String (100)

Direct

markauto_StartDate

DateTime

Direct

markauto_TimeZone

String (10)

Direct

markauto_TouchPoint

String (100)

Direct

markauto_UserAgent

String (64)

Direct

markauto_WebBrowserID

String (150)

Direct

markauto_WebSessionID

String (100)

Direct

Ma_webactivitydetail (Web Activity Detail)

CRM Field

Type\Size

Relationship

markauto_duration

Decimal

Direct

markauto_entrypage

String (1)

Direct

markauto_exitpage

String (1)

Direct

markauto_hostname

String (250)

Direct

markauto_interactiondate

DateTime

Direct

markauto_name

String (300)

Direct

markauto_parameters

String (250)

Direct

markauto_path

String (250)

Direct

markauto_protocol

String (250)

Direct

markauto_referrer

String (1000)

Direct

markauto_webactivityid

Lookup (WebActivity)

WebActivityDetail.WebActivityID = WebActivity.WebActivity ID

markauto_webactivityidname

String (200)

Direct

markauto_webinteractionid

String (100)

Direct

markauto_websessionid

String (100)

Direct